Title: An Unwelcome Souvenir
Challenge: trimming the tree
Word Count: 100


"Here." Severus floated the box over to Remus. "Don't blame me when the branches collapse."

"I'm not putting them all out," said Remus. "Only - bugger. I thought I'd got rid of this one."

Severus peered over his shoulder to see a glass ball labeled "Our First Christmas 1998." Of all the things for Nymphadora to have left!

"Here." He plucked it from Remus's hand and transfigured it into a silver moon. "It should be easier for you to smash like this."

"Rather," said Remus. He took a deep breath, closed his eyes, and chucked the moon into the fire.
